ZDZISŁAW WIATR (born 1960)
He graduated from the Academy of Fine Arts in Cracow, at the Faculty of Graphic Arts in Katowice, where in 1986 he received a diploma with the honourable mention. In the years 1986-1987 he was a scholarship holder of the Minister of Culture and Art. He is currently an associate professor at the Institute of Arts of the J. Dlugosz Academy in Czestochowa.
His work has been exhibited at numerous individual and collective exhibitions in the country (eg at the International Print Triennial in Krakow in 1991 and 2003 or the Polish Graphic Triennial in Katowice in 2003) and abroad, i.a. in Finland and the Czech Republic.
Awards: distinctions at the International Exhibition Of Miniature Art in Toronto in 1989 and 1991; distinction, "Misterium cierpienia - misterium odkupienia", 2005; peer award, "Gdy słowo staje się obrazem", 2006.
